Many users accidentally place their BIOS files inside individual system folders (e.g., BIOS/PS1/scph5501.bin ). Lemuroid's core detection system cannot read nested subdirectories. Game Boy Advance (GBA) Tap (or Allow access

Move all your downloaded or dumped BIOS files directly into the newly created BIOS folder.

After setting the directory, return to the main Lemuroid menu. Tap the three dots in the top-right corner and select . Lemuroid will scan your ROMs alongside the newly linked BIOS folder to verify system compatibility. Troubleshooting Common Lemuroid BIOS Issues
